A Catholic priest believes that a higher proportion of women in his congregation regularly attend services than the men in his congregation. He randomly selects 100 men and 100 women from his congregation and finds that 32 men and 48 women regularly attend.
A) Specify the competing hypotheses to test the priest's claim.
B) Calculate the value of the relevant test statistic.
C) Compute the p-value. Does the evidence support the priest's claim at the 1% significance level?
Cerebellum
The cerebellum is a part of the brain located under the cerebrum, responsible for coordinating voluntary movements and maintaining balance and posture.
White Matter
Central nervous system tissue consisting primarily of myelin-wrapped axons.
Myelinated Axons
Axons that are covered with a fatty substance called myelin, which increases the speed at which electrical impulses propagate along the nerve cell.
Cephalization
Evolutionary trend whereby neurons that detect stimuli and process information become concentrated in the head of a bilateral animal.
